Reports claim scientists study what happens to the brain when folks watch entertainment violence. On one hand, in order to facilitate social justice, folks have to witness violence in photojournalism and film. On the other, the culture of violence out there sucks. So does bad storytelling.
Columbia scientists show that a brain network responsible for suppressing behaviors like inappropriate or unwarranted aggression (including the right lateral orbitofrontal cortex, or right ltOFC, and the amygdala) became less active after study subjects watched several short clips from popular movies depicting acts of violence. These changes could render people less able to control their own aggressive behavior.
